ROBYN SINGER ( writer ), JORGE SANTIAGO JR. ( Artist ), HARRY SAXON ( Coloring ), and GEORGE GANT ( Lettering) debut with a dark social commentary about the grip of predatory society with… FINAL GAMBLE.
Final Gamble Summary:
Gambling addict Danny Lin, and disgraced MMA fighter Jasmeet Khanna have both fallen on hard times. Owing an enormous amount of money to a loan shark named Mandy, they are offered the chance to save themselves by winning the money they need–in a game of poker against her. Unable to work together, the two men are easily defeated.
As a result of their defeat, the two become prisoners of The Mercury Society, a group composed of the richest and most powerful people in the world.
In this unforgiving Hell, people are forced to fight to the death in an elite gamble for their souls.

About the Comic:
TARGETS is a 12 issue spy series written by Ryan O’Connell, Art by Desi Alicea-Aponte and Dee Noonan, Letters by Jerome Gagnon. It follows an international spy and the woman hired to kill him, decades after they’ve fallen in love and settled down. But when their cushy suburban life is threatened by their past, they’ll do whatever it takes to keep their children safe. Even if it means teaching them to kill.

About Lost Between Worlds:
Gwynn Ap Nudd is one of many Reapers, given the mission of collecting the souls of the dead on a daily basis. One day she is tasked with collecting the soul of someone named Verda, but when approached, the man claims to be named Dospe, and have Dissociative Identity Disorder. Could this man be telling the truth, or is he trying to find some loop hole to try and cheat death?
Unbeknownst to Gwynn, more trouble seems to be looming in the horizon that could affect both the world of the living, and the dead. Join Gwynn on the beginning of her adventure between worlds to find out what happens, just don't get lost along the way!

About 2100 Samurai:
2100 Samurai takes a feudal Samurai who is transported to the Cyberpunk world of 2100, where earth metals are extinct, technology controls everything and he must adapt and survive this unfamiliar landscape of Neo Detroit.
About Screecher:
Screecher takes a young girl trying to exonerate her Father from a wrongful conviction and seek justice to those that have wronged her by becoming a Superhero.

About #frankenstein the Unconquered comic :
Frankenstein's monster thaws from the ice 500 years in the future to find a bombed out apocalypse as hideous and broken as he is. It is an epic horror action series that reads like Conan the Barbarian meets Universal Horror Monsters.
About MechaTon #comic :
A cool comic about a glove that turns anything it punches into a battle mech and the two idiots that get their hands on it. It's got action, it's got heart, it's got kaiju fights. What's not to love?

About Corollary:
In a galaxy filled with twin moons, twin suns, and twin planets, everything
comes in twos. Even the people. And if your twin dies … so do you. This is
the way it's always been. So, when Captain Andromeda's twin loses her life
in a far-off military battle, and Captain Andromeda herself DOES NOT die,
needless to say, the universe demands answers. Answers that the Captain is
willing to give … to the highest bidder, of course. This is COROLLARY – a
four-issue bombastic sci-fi romp.

Silverline Comics has created over thirty comic books with various talent from formerly Malibu comics and other talented creators throughout the years and are too numerous to mention here. Silverline comics also has crowdfunding campaigns every other month as well showcasing the different genres of comics at each Kickstarter campaign.
Roland Mann stops by Two Geeks Talking to discuss his career, the Superhero Kickstarter campaign (see link below) for Trumps, Switchblade and Teen Beetle. His journey from working for Malibu comics to Marvel to Silverline Comics, to briefly retiring, then starting back up Silverline comics. Roland also talks about literary works from The Red Badge of Courage to Huckleberry Finn to Mark Twain's Fenimore Cooper's Literary Offenses essay; How to write dialogue for comics and How the next generation will have to handle the comics landscape... plus, much more!
This is an in-depth look into creative writing, comic writing process and more than I can describe here.

About Territory:
TERRITORY is a post-apocalyptic kaiju story set in a far distant Pacific Northwest of the United States. Ancestors tell the story of how civilization was wiped from the earth in nuclear fire long ago. From the ashes of the destruction rose the Behemoths, giant creatures whose presence breathed life back into the land. The surviving people now live in tribes, worshiping the Behemoths as gods!
